Often spoken of but not seen, the Riffroc are the pride of the Daiya family, with Nai’o taking great care of them at the Central Stables in Kilima Village. A Fast Travel Stable Board can also be found at this location; however, a suspicious hay pile containing half-eaten carrots can be found and is connected to a Found Item quest, Not Hungry.

Speak to Nai’o to learn about this discovery and help him cheer up one of the Riffrocs, who has been feeling rather blue. Help Nai’o lift a Riffroc’s spirits in completing the Not Hungry Found Item quest and enjoy some carrots themselves in Palia.

Palia Not Hungry Found Item Quest Objectives List

This Found Item quest can begin after finding a pile of half-eaten carrots near the Central Stables in Kilima Village. This is the location where players can discover Kenyatta and Nai’o standing beside the Fast Travel Stable Board at various times of the day, but the stables are where the Riffrocs are kept.

Search the hay pile at Central Stables in Kilima Village to find some half-eaten carrots. (Picture: Singularity 6 / Ashleigh Klein)

By completing this quest, players can explore the mystery behind the half-eaten carrots, which Riffroc hasn’t been eating properly. Below, we have detailed all the quest objectives that players can follow to help them complete this Found Item quest for Palia:

  • Talk to Nai’o 
  • Find someone who can make a blue ribbon for Sugarfoot
  • Get five Fabric
  • Get three Common Blue Butterflies
    • Return to Jel

How To Complete The Not Hungry Found Item Quest In Palia?

Take some time exploring the barns at the Central Stables near the Mayor’s Estate in Kilima Village to find some half-eaten carrots. As the Daiya family manages these stables, players head to the family farm and speak to Nai’o about discovering these carrots.

After finding the eaten carrots, they can find and speak to Nai'o about this discovery. (Picture: Singularity 6 / Ashleigh Klein)

He’ll explain that one of the Riffrocs, Sugarfoot, hasn’t been herself for the last few days, which he revealed that it started at a competition to make her stand out. Since then, Sugarfoot had been feeling “down in the dumps,” and he’s trying to find a way to lift her spirits and make her feel like a winner.

As Nai’o explained, the winner always receives a blue ribbon, and players can speak to Jel to craft a big blue ribbon just for Sugarfoot. They’ll need to get some Fabric, which can be bought from Tish’s Furniture Store or placing Cotton in the Fabric Loom Hopper, and they need Common Blue Butterflies, which are commonly found in any field, forest, or rocky areas of Kilima Village, including Mirror Fields and Leafhopper Hills.

They can bring the items to Jel, who will use them to craft a blue ribbon before he delivers it to Nai’o to complete the quest. Players can get ten Renown upon its completion, and post-quest, Nai’o will send them ten bags of Carrot Seeds attached to a letter.
